Comprehending the ÖSD B2 Level
The B2 level, according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), shows that a learner can comprehend the primary concepts of complex text on both concrete and abstract topics, consisting of technical discussions in their field of specialization. Prospects at this level can interact with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es regular interaction with native speakers rather possible without pressure for either celebration.

The ÖSD B2 exam is divided into two primary modules: the Written Exam (Reading, Listening, Writing) and the Oral Exam (Speaking). Prospects have the option to take these modules together or individually.
Table 1: ÖSD B2 Exam BreakdownModuleSub-SectionPeriodDescriptionComposedChecking Out (Lesen)90 MinutesUnderstanding of four various text types (e.g., short articles, advertisements).WrittenListening (Hören)Approx. 30 MinutesComprehending three audio jobs (conversations, radio reports).ComposedComposing (Schreiben)90 MinutesProduction of two texts (a formal email/letter and an essay/commentary).OralSpeaking (Sprechen)15-- 20 MinutesA three-part discussion (interacting socially, topic conversation, and simulation).The Benefits of an Online Preparation Program

Understanding how the exam is graded is necessary for trainee self-confidence.
Table 3: Passing ScoresModuleOptimum PointsPassing Score (60%)Written (Reading, Listening, Writing)70 Points42 PointsOral (Speaking)30 Points18 PointsTotal100 Points60 Points
Note: In the ÖSD B2, the prospect needs to pass both the written and oral parts to get the full diploma. If only one part is passed, a partial certificate for that module is issued.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Is the ÖSD B2 certificate legitimate forever?
Yes, ÖSD certificates do not formally end. Nevertheless, some employers or universities might require a certificate that is no more than 2 years of ages to ensure present efficiency.
2. Can the real exam be taken online?
While the preparation is carried out online, the official ÖSD B2 Prüfung Kaufen B2 exam need to be taken in person at a certified examination center. This makes sure the stability and security of the screening environment.

4. What is the distinction in between ÖSD and Goethe-Zertifikat?
Both are globally recognized and have extremely comparable formats. The primary distinction depends on the local focus; ÖSD consists of linguistic variations typical in Austria, Switzerland, and Germany (pluricentric technique), whereas Goethe focuses mostly on the German utilized in Germany.
